Why Morocco Friendship Golf?

Morocco Friendship Golf celebrates the historic bond of friendship—rooted in Morocco’s early recognition of American independence and embodied by Payne Stewart, whose victories at the Hassan II Trophy reflected his role as a true global ambassador of goodwill in golf.

Payne Stewart, immortalized at Pinehurst and in Morocco

Payne Stewart's legacy lives on—immortalized in bronze in Morocco as well as at Pinehurst, inspiring golfers worldwide with his spirit of friendship and excellence.  Reflecting Payne's strong family values, this trip is designed with couples in mind, including a full agenda for spouses who do not play golf
